the minor medical consent form is a document used by a parent or legal guardian to authorize someone else to provide health care and health care decisions on behalf of the minor the extent of the consent given to a third party is usually limited and should be determined only for a designated period usually six to twelve months in which the parents or legal guardian are not available consequently in most states its required that there is an end to a child medical consent if this requirement is not met the minor medical consent form may be considered invalid its always recommended to authorize the form in the presence of a notary public or a witness in order to increase the formality of the form and further acceptance by the healthcare facilities

What are the 4 principles of informed consent? The patient must be able to make a decision. There must be an explanation of information before a decision is made. The patient must understand the medical information given. The patient must understand their decision is voluntary.
Lack Of Informed Consent A common example of this is when a patient has religious objections to a proposed course of treatment. When these disagreements occur, doctors cannot provide the treatment without the patients consent. Successful treatment will not protect the doctors from liability.

Informed consent is the process in which a health care provider educates a patient about the risks, benefits, and alternatives of a given procedure or intervention. The patient must be competent to make a voluntary decision about whether to undergo the procedure or intervention.
There are 4 components of informed consent including decision capacity, documentation of consent, disclosure, and competency. Doctors will give you information about a particular treatment or test in order for you to decide whether or not you wish to undergo a treatment or test.
Informed consent means approval of the legal representative of the child and/or of the competent child for medical interventions following appropriate information. National legal regulations differ in regard to the question when a child has the full right to give his or her autonomous consent.
Informed consent should include alternatives to the proposed treatment or procedure. The law permits a presumption of consent during emergency situations. IRBs may waive the informed consent requirement for research that only involves retrospective record of patient records.
What Is Informed Consent? The name of your condition. The name of the procedure or treatment that the health care provider recommends. Risks and benefits of the treatment or procedure. Risks and benefits of other options, including not getting the treatment or procedure.
